I third this. I recently switched my "95 BMW M3's front pads to
Porterfield R4S because I got tired of having filthy front wheels every 3
days. They work great and what little dust I am seeing is probably just
from the road. My Pantera has two calipers on each rear wheel, and already
has what I call "violent" stopping power; but the Porterfields would
probably improve it further.
